Merging two individuals from different family cultures can create conflict with their families of origin. The couples who deal with it most successfully have the courage and strength to decide what is best for them. This is No. 3 in a series of 20 NebGuides that focus on building and maintaining strong couple and family relationships written by a team of University of Nebraska–Lincoln Extension Educators.
